McGowan Government launches ‘Beyond 2020 – WA Youth Action Plan’
$200,000 allocated for the 2020-21 COVID-19 Youth Recovery Grants program
Nominations for the Youth Recovery Grants program open from January 20, 2021 and close on March 18, 2021
The Plan outlines the important first steps the McGowan Government has taken in supporting young people through the COVID-19 pandemic.
The Plan also provides an important foundation and future road map to assist WA youth on the road to recovery and beyond, with the next phase of engagement and planning to focus on the systematic changes required to ensure young people in WA are able to continue to thrive and reach their potential.

Nominations open for STA Board General Cluster Representative
Are you a STEM professional passionate about our sector, and keen to make a difference? Then we need you! Science & Technology Australia is seeking nominations for the STA Board General Cluster Representative position.
To nominate, you must be a member of an STA ordinary member (non-affiliate) in the general science & technology cluster.
We seek outstanding candidates to make an active, thoughtful, skilled and principled contribution to STA, and particularly encourage nominations from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ander people, people from culturally diverse backgrounds, LGBTQI individuals and people living with disability.
